Method for analyzing suspended solids, floating substance analyzing apparatus and ultrasonic attenuation spectrum analyzing apparatus using the same

PROBLEM TO BE SOLVED: To provide a suspended matter analysis method, a suspended matter analysis device using the same and an ultrasonic attenuation spectrum analysis device which automatically and continuously analyze, in real time, a concentration and grain size distribution of suspended matters with the concentration and the grain size distribution thereof simultaneously varying in water.SOLUTION: A suspended matter analysis method obtains a concentration and a grain size distribution function of suspended matters in liquid through the processes to calculate: a sonic speed and a wave length from measurement data using predetermined formulas (a); amplitude of a reference spectrum using a predetermined formula (b); a measurement value of an attenuation coefficient using a predetermined formula (c); an estimation value of the attenuation coefficient using predetermined formulas (d); and a volume percent concentration and the grain size distribution which minimize a dispersion of a deviation between the measurement value calculated in the process (c) and the estimation value calculated in the process (d) using a predetermined formula.
